Group portrait. 8 persons (men and young boys) carrying kavadi (a ceremonial sacrifice and offering practiced by devotees during the worship of Lord Murugan, the Hindu God of War. It is a central part of the festival of Thaipusam and emphasizes debt bondage). They are wearing full sleeve shirt, veshti, a peace of cloth tied around their waist, rosarie made of dried seed of an Indian native tree (rudratcha malai) with pendant around the neck and turban. People are standing behind them.
